Special Features and the Jackpot Gathering System
The heart of Dragon Pots Megaways is centered around its pot collection feature, which transforms what could have been a standard Megaways slot into something far more interactive. Scatter symbols land on the reels as golden pots, and landing four or more initiates the free spins round. Before the feature begins, you are given a choice that I found genuinely strategic: you can select more free spins with a lower starting multiplier, or fewer spins with a higher initial multiplier. This risk-reward decision adds a layer of engagement that suits the analytical mindset of many UK players. During the free spins, every cascade boosts the win multiplier by one, with no upper limit, and additional scatter symbols grant extra spins. The pot collection element comes into play through special dragon pot symbols that are displayed on the top tracker reel and occasionally on the main reels. These pots are available in three colours, green, red and gold, each corresponding to a different prize tier. Collecting matching pots completes a meter, and once filled, gives an instant cash prize or additional free spins. I triggered this collection mechanic several times during my review period, and it reliably delivered a satisfying boost, especially during the free spins round where the multiplier had already climbed. The feature buy option, where available at UK-licensed casinos, allows you to purchase direct entry into the free spins for a cost of around 100x your stake, though I always recommend verifying the specific terms at your chosen site. Below is a overview of the key bonus elements I encountered:
- Free Spins Selection: Choose between 15 spins with a 1x starting multiplier, 10 spins with a 5x multiplier, or 5 spins with a 10x multiplier, with a mystery option offering a random combination.
- Pot Gathering Meter: Green pots award 5x to 15x stake, red pots give 20x to 50x stake, and gold pots give 100x to 500x stake when the corresponding meter fills completely.
- Top Tracker Wilds: The horizontal reel can add up to four wild symbols that substitute for all paying symbols except scatters and pot symbols, significantly increasing win potential during both base game and free spins.
- Tumble Multiplier: During free spins, each successive cascade boosts the win multiplier by one, with no cap, offering the potential for enormous payouts if you chain multiple tumbles together.

The way the Megaways Engine Operates in Quick Spin Gaming’s Take
Dragon Pots Megaways uses the licensed Big Time Gaming mechanic that changes the number of symbols appearing on each reel with every spin, delivering up to 117,649 ways to win. Quick Spin Gaming has built this engine with a six-reel setup plus an extra horizontal top tracker reel that introduces even more symbols to the mix. What I observed during my testing is that the cascading wins feature, where winning symbols vanish and new ones drop down to replace them, runs particularly smoothly here. There is no lag between cascades, which is important enormously when you are attempting to fit multiple spins into a two-minute break. The game determines wins from left to right on adjacent reels regardless of symbol size, and the dynamic reel heights ensure you can get anywhere from 64 to the maximum number of ways on any given spin. I maintained a close eye on how often the higher Megaways configurations triggered, and while the full 117,649 ways is rare, the game frequently settles in the 20,000 to 50,000 range, keeping the base game engaging. The top tracker reel displays four additional symbols that can include wilds or high-value icons, and this horizontal row often turned out to be the difference between a dead spin and a modest return. For UK players who value the mathematical transparency that the UK Gambling Commission encourages, the paytable is clearly accessible and updates dynamically based on your stake. I considered the betting range, which typically starts at £0.20 and extends up to £20 per spin in most UK-facing casinos, to be well calibrated for both cautious between-rounds punters and those ready to push a little harder during a dedicated session.
